Job Description:

We are looking for a Cover Manager & Data Officer from September, to provide effective and efficient Cover arrangements across the school and to assist the Examinations Officer in supporting the management of student data systems and administration of internal and external examinations. The successful candidate will be working 37 hours per week TTO + 2 weeks. This is a vital function, completing daily administration for cover, training and deployment of Cover Supervisors, as well as assisting with the organisation of internal and external examinations in line with school need and national requirements, organising student performance data in order to drive improvement. As part of the cover role, you will be responsible for organising daily cover for absent staff and manage and co-ordinate the school cover diary which details planned absences, meetings, school trips and training, plus any unplanned absences, liaising with agencies , staff and senior leadership. Cover timetable and room changes will be identified, prioritised and planned for accordingly to ensure minimum disruption for our pupils. The successful candidate must have strong organisational skills, attention to detail, the ability to respond proactively to staffing challenges, excellent communication skills as well as looking to take on responsibility in the role. Previous experience of working in a school setting with children and young people is essential, as is a desire to want to make a difference.
